In a message on Tuesday to the FBI director Cash Patel, Grassley presented his findings with the expression of frustration with dealing with the agency for a “anti -Catholic” memorandum under Ray and its alleged lack of transparency. Rayi told Congress that the memo was a single producer by one field office.

Despite WRAY allegations that the memo was one product, the FBI found 13 additional documents for the FBI and five FBI attachments that used the “traditional, extremist Catholic” terms and cited the South Poverty Center (Splc).

Grassley said that the second FBI memorandum formulated by the Richmond FBI to distribute the office repeated the baseless link between the traditional Catholicism and violent extremism, noting that it was never published due to a violent reaction after the general disclosure of the first note.

The new documents issued by Grassley show that Richmond’s note has been distributed to more than 1,000 FBI employees worldwide. An email exchange shows the Federal Bureau of the Federal Investigation Office in Bovalo, New York, expressing their concerns about the hate sets set by the Splc, mentioned in the Richmond Memorandum, which was in its field of responsibility.

Grassley said that the FBI relied on “deep -biased sources” used in the memo.
